How Does the UK Version Differ from the US Version?

Now, let's talk about why so many of you are keen to get your eyes on the UK version of Love Island in the first place. While both versions share the same core concept – singles coupling up in a villa, facing challenges, and aiming to find love (and win some cash) – there are some pretty noticeable differences that give the UK edition its unique flavor. For starters, the vibe is often different. The UK contestants tend to be a bit more… unfiltered, shall we say? There's a certain rawness and a lack of polished performance that many viewers find more authentic and entertaining. The humor can also be a bit drier and more self-deprecating in the UK version. Another biggie is the recoupling ceremonies. In the UK, the power often shifts dramatically, leading to more unpredictable and dramatic moments. While the US version has adopted many of the UK's traditions, the execution and the contestant dynamics can still lead to vastly different outcomes. The slang, the cultural references, and even the types of challenges thrown at the islanders can feel distinctly British. Some fans argue that the UK version leans more into the chaos and the genuine, messy relationships, whereas the US version sometimes feels a bit more curated or perhaps aims for a broader, more mainstream appeal. Ultimately, both have their charms, but if you're drawn to a slightly wilder, more unpredictable reality TV experience, the UK version is usually the one to beat.
